pjmacl - (October 10, 2004) This compact DVD player is an excellent package at the price. In addition to all the usual features of a high end player, and so far flawless operation, it provides an interpolated DVI output providing 1080i to compatible HDTVs. The resulting excellent video quality is a pleasure watch. If you are looking for this capability the Denon DVD-1910 is the way to go. Before buying this unit I had a disastrous experience with the Samsung DVD-HD841 (which I returned) which claims the same capabilities. However as noted in my review of that product the Samsung is not fully compliant with HDCP making the use of DVI problematic, and amazingly the DVI output setting is not retained after power down

jensen18 - (09/16/2009) I bought this unit without doing much reseach due to a deal when buying a Samsung TV. The TV is outstanding the DVD player not so much. The unit stopped reading disks and would just boot to the splash screen after 3 weeks. This was after the date I could get my money back from the store so was only able to swap out for a new one. We proceeded to swap the next three units. The 5th one is now intermittently reading disks. Samsung wants me to pay for shipping to have them take a look which ends up being greater than 10% of the original cost of the unit. After doing the proper research on this unit it appears that it should be called the F1080 paper weight. When it actually works the picture is good but the touch sensitive buttons are really annoying. Try reaching behind the unit to adjust other AV cables and suddenly the DVD tray is popping open. I would much prefer to have to press a button for it to respond. Due to my experience with this unit I doubt I will even consider a Samsung branded DVD player in the future.
